Marilou’s Long Nose
by Raymond Plante
illustrated by Marie-Claude Favreau
translated by Sarah Cummins
Marilou cannot stop telling stories and white lies.
Marilou can't stop telling stories and white lies. She finds they just pop out without thinking. Now her friends have challenged each other - the first person to tell a lie has to wear a false nose. Poor Marilou. She doesn't want to tell her dad why she looks like Pinocchio, but worst of all she doesn't want Freddy Busker to ask her about the nose.
About the Authors
Raymond Plante
RAYMOND PLANTE has written more than 20 books for children and young adults. Among his many distinctions is the Mr Christie Children's Book Award which he received in 1995.
